Hi, I'm new here and this is my first posting. Here is a penny I found in a roll. Couldn't help but notice a missing A. Any insight on this would be highly appreciated.

 Posted 06/15/2022  4:00 pm  Show Profile   Bookmark this reply Add JimmyD to your friends list Get a Link to this Reply
You can see other letters that are also light..
Due to a partially Grease Filled Die.
A fairly common occurance.

First welcome to CCF. Second, I agree with this weakness of strike likely being due to a little grease in the die. It is a little hard to know for sure though with this amount of circulation wear.
